Sweet Walnut Maple Bars
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 30 Minutes
Cook Time: 30 Minutes
Ready In: 60 Minutes
Servings: 6
These sound really good, and remind me of a sort of twist on pecan pie.
Ingredients:
1 (18 1/4 ounce) package duncan hines moist deluxe classic yellow cake mix, divided
1/3 cup butter or 1/3 cup margarine, melted
1 egg
1 1/3 cups maple syrup
3 eggs
1/3 cup light brown sugar, packed
1/2 teaspoon maple flavoring or 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up walnuts, chopped
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ees, and grease a 13x9x2 inch baking pan.
2. For Crust:.
3. Reserve 2/3 cup of the cake mix and set it aside; combine remaining cake mix, melted butter, and egg in a large bowl.
4. Stir until thoroughly blended. (Mixture will be crumbly).
5. Press mixture into prepared pan and bake for 15-20 minutes, or until light golden brown.
6. For Topping:.
7. Combine reserved cake mix, maple syrup, eggs, brown sugar, and maple flavoring in a large bowl.
8. Beat at low speed with electric mixer for 3 minutes, then pour over crust and sprinkle with walnuts.
9. Return pan to oven and bake for 30-35 minutes, or until filling is set.
10. Cool completely and cut into bars.
11. Store any leftover bars in refrigerator.
